#230c4d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#230c4d is composed of 13.7% red, 4.7%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.5% cyan, 84.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 261.2 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 17.5%. #230c4d color hex could be obtained by blending #46189a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#230c4d color description : Very dark violet.

#230c4d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#230c4d has RGB values of R:35, G:12,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 2296909.

Shades and Tints of #230c4d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040109 is the darkest color, while #f9f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#230c4d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2c2b2e is the less saturated color, while #200257 is the most saturated one.
